
Stephen Miles
- Managing Partner
- Chicago
In 2007, Steve co-founded and is the Managing Partner of Livingstone’s US operations. In the US, Steve drives Livingstone’s strategic growth initiatives, including business development, recruitment, and client relations. Over the last decade, Livingstone has rapidly grown into an international mid-market M&A and debt advisory firm with 85 professionals, offices in 6 countries, and recently climbed the ranks to be named one of the most active banks in the mid-market by Mergers & Acquisitions.
In addition to his responsibilities as Managing Partner, Steve serves on the company’s board of directors, acting as Board Chairman since 2016. In this role, he has overseen many of the company’s most ambitious strategic global growth initiatives as well as the hiring of key senior leaders and the expansion of the firm.
Steve has 25 years of experience as an advisor, having successfully advised on 100+ transactions. When leading engagements, he draws on his years of experience successfully advising mid-market companies on M&A transactions, financial restructurings, and debt and equity raises. Moreover, his experiences as a business owner and entrepreneur inform his perspective, providing greater insight into the unique challenges of running and selling a business. Consequently, he brings deep understanding and clarity when tailoring custom recommendations for clients.
Prior to Livingstone, Steve was a Managing Director at M&A firm Brown Gibbons Lang & Co. and Lazard, where he honed his skills advising mid-market companies.
An avid believer in equanimity, Steve sits on the board for BUILD (Broader Urban Involvement & Leadership Development), one of Chicago’s leading gang intervention, violence prevention, and youth development organizations. Steve enthusiastically raises funds for the nationally respected organization.
Education:
- MBA, Washington University
- BS, University of Missouri
